Abstract

Apparatus for controlling the outflow of a syphonic cistern comprises positioning an aperture at an adjustable cistern low water level in order to admit air via a duct to the interior of the syphon and break the syphonic action when the cistern water level falls to a desired level. <IMAGE>

Description

VARIABLE QUANTITY FLUSHER.
Consists of a half-inch o/d rubber tube connected to the top cverfall which allows air in to break instantly the symphonic action of the flush.
Once the water level has dropped below the open end of the rubber tube allowing air to be sucked in by the vacuum in the overfall thus breaking the syphonic action of the water, the water stops flowing.
The amount of water required is regulated by a control lever attached to the open end of the rubber tube. The open end of the flexible tube regulates the level of the required water.
The amount control lever is easily fixed to the lid of the tank.

Claims (4)

1. The application is for a water saving device for use on toilet cisterns.
2. It consists of a flexible tube which esters into the top of thc inverted U-tube of a toilet cistern. The other end of the flexible tube is held below the surface level of the water in the cistern maintaining an air lock.
3. hen there is a syphonic action causing the water in the tank to drop, a water lock is maintained by the flexible tube. When the toilet is flushed and the water level dros to below the entrance of the flexible tube, the water seal is broken allowing air pressure te enter the inverted U-tube, t1us breaking the vacuum and releasing the flow of water into the cistern. The end of this flexible tube is attached to a hand controlled lever, which is adjustable to the volume of water required for each flush.
4. With existing systems the volume of water allowed to flaw from the cIstern is directly controlled by the operator. i.e. by the length of time the flush handle is held down. With MY system the amount of water allowed to Leave the cistern is pre-set, and therefore not varied according to the operators action.
